大孔吸附树脂纯化山茱萸总皂苷的动态洗脱条件研究

摘要: 运用单因素试验和正交试验研究了山茱萸总皂苷在HPD-300大孔吸附树脂上的动态洗脱工艺,经极差分析和方差分析确定了其最佳操作条件。结果表明,最佳蒸馏水洗脱条件为:水洗流速1.0BV/h,用水量2.2BV,水洗时间2.2h;最佳洗脱剂洗脱条件为乙醇浓度50%,洗脱流速2.0BV/h,洗脱剂用量4.5BV。

Abstract: This experiment studied dynamic de-adsorption technology of total saposins from Cornus officinalis in HPD-300 macroporous resin by single factor tests and orthogonal test designs.The optimal manipulation conditions were ascertained by variance analyses.The results showed that the optimum desorption conditions are:flowing rate 1.0 BV/h,volume 2.2 BV,and desorption time 2.2 h;The best desorption conditions by alcohol are 50% concentration,flowing rate 2.0 BV/h,and desoprtion volume 4.5 BV.
